    movieman_kev

    Sucky sense is tingeling

    A soft-core parody of Spiderman. Misty Mundae is Patricia Porker, a nerd, who gets bitten by a spider and becomes spiderbabe. And yes her web shooting abilities ARE organic, but they don't come from he wrists...I wanted to like this movie, I really did. I started the dvd with high hopes. Alas this film has 3 strikes against it. The comedy just isn't funny. Strike one. It seems too long. strike TWO. And the sex scenes...well they're not sexy. STRIKE THREE!! I'm sorry to all who were involved in this film, but in this outing you've just been struck out.

    My Grade: D

    6Animus

    yes its soft-core porn, but its funny soft-core porn....

    I admit I watched this movie because it was made by the people who did Lord of the G-Strings (another hysterical soft-core cable porn film) and had Misty Mundae (the original Misty not the new girl). The writer (West) seems to have a knack for send ups of big budget movies. The movie is a simple enough knock off of Spiderman but its the way it is pulled off that makes it worth watching, I suggest a 2 drink minimum for any guests who you intend to show it to though. Misty is a hoot as Patricia Porker and her aunt and uncle are twisted enough to make them funny. If you liked "Lord of the G-Strings" or "Playmate of the Apes" by the same people you'll like this one. By the way my comments are from the cable version, it's my understanding the DVD is unrated.

    liudragon

    lack of Effort, poor results

    Supposedly someone at EI came up with the great idea of aiming their cameras at Misty Mundae, think of s supposedly funny ripoff of a popular movie, take off Misty's clothes and you'll come up with a classic video. Time after time they are wrong, wrong, wrong. Misty's fun to look at but her acting has never improved enough to make her into a credible performer. This whole affair is amateurish and the poor camera-work and direction make this into another disappointing outing for EI and the unamusingly named director Johnny Crash. (Would that be funny to a 3rd grader?) A sexy farce of Spider-man is a good idea but let's let someone else with imagination and talent take a shot at it next time.
